Being a stay-at-home mom is a full-time job that requires patience, dedication, and a lot of hard work. If you're considering this path, here are some tips on how to be a successful stay-at-home mom: 1. Establish a routine: One of the biggest challenges of being a stay-at-home mom is the lack of structure in your day. Creating a routine for yourself and your children can help establish a sense of normalcy and make it easier to manage your time. 2. Set boundaries: Being a stay-at-home mom can blur the lines between work and personal life. It's important to set boundaries and make time for yourself to recharge and pursue your own interests. 3. Find a support system: Being a stay-at-home mom can be isolating at times. Find other stay-at-home moms in your community, join parenting groups or playdates, or consider hiring a babysitter or nanny to give yourself a break. 4. Stay organized: Keeping your home and family organized can help reduce stress and make it easier to manage your responsibilities. Develop a system for household tasks, such as meal planning and cleaning, and involve your children in age-appropriate chores. 5. Take care of yourself: As a stay-at-home mom, it can be easy to put your own needs last. However, it's important to prioritize self-care and make time for exercise, relaxation, and hobbies that make you happy. 6. Focus on quality time with your children: While it's important to maintain a routine and stay organized, don't forget to prioritize quality time with your children. Set aside time each day for reading, playing, and other activities that strengthen your bond. 7. Keep learning: As a stay-at-home mom, it's important to continue learning and growing, both for your own personal development and to be a positive role model for your children. Consider taking online classes, reading books, or attending workshops to expand your knowledge and skills. Remember, being a stay-at-home mom is a rewarding but challenging job. With the right mindset and strategies, you can successfully navigate this role and create a fulfilling life for yourself and your family.
